我有一个revit文件,可以通过云将其转换为svf并在3D查看器中查看。它既可以直接转换为.rvt文件,也可以作为navisworks addin导出器的导出。
我的问题: 我希望我的应用程序的用户也可以在revit中查看楼层2D视图。
我查看了所有清单文件,但没有看到楼层视图的f2d。
您建议我用于2D视图?请注意,我将有许多图纸要处理/查看,所以我不希望为每个视图导出dwg然后转换它们。我希望有一个特殊的设置,我可以传递给将创建2D视图的转换器
(注意:我还希望能够动态地突出显示/纹理此视图的房间。所以我需要能够像在3D查看器中那样访问几何体)
答案 0 :(得分:1)
Afaik Revit项目文件中定义的所有2D视图都会自动翻译并包含在Forge输出中。你看过LmvNav样本了吗?
https://calm-inlet-4387.herokuapp.com
它显示2D和3D视图。
请注意“辅助视图”下拉列表中的可用2D视图列表:
它甚至链接两个视图中的元素,以便在一个中选择的任何内容在另一个中突出显示:
您可以检查它从哪里获取2D流。源代码在GitHub上:
https://github.com/JimAwe/LmvNavTest
我认为您选择在向观众提供2D或3D流时是否需要2D流或3D流。
答案 1 :(得分:0)
添加到Jeremy's,仅供参考 - 如果您正在寻找已发布模型的方法,这无济于事。但是如果你不是这样的话,你可能还想知道 - 如果你有一个revit模型,有一个UI工具可以选择你想要包含的视图。
https://fieldofviewblog.wordpress.com/2016/04/02/selecting-views-to-publish-revit-project-on-a360/